forum.bitel.ru
http://forum.bitel.ru/

Списание АП раз в N-месяцев
http://forum.bitel.ru/viewtopic.php?f=16&t=5885
Страница 1 из 1

Автор:  mikos [ 14 сен 2011, 16:13 ]
Заголовок сообщения:  Списание АП раз в N-месяцев

Подскажите пожалуйста, как сделать тарифы, со списанием АП допустим раз в 6 месяцев?
Вижу у тарифов режимы списания - помесячный и погодовой. Пока на ум приходит только заводить отдельное поле и указывать дату следующего списания для отдельного списка тарифов. Костыль какой-то получается...

Автор:  mikos [ 15 сен 2011, 13:17 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

Есть варианты? Кроме выдачи бонусов, естественно.

Автор:  Cromeshnic [ 15 сен 2011, 14:02 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

Разве что скриптом списывать RSCM

Автор:  mikos [ 15 сен 2011, 14:17 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

Cromeshnic писал(а):
Разве что скриптом списывать RSCM

То есть вообще отказаться от NPAY модуля? Хм.

По идее, мне важно, чтобы абонент внес сумму, равную стоимость его тарифа за 6 месяцев, а там пускай каждый месяц списывается. Хотя и тут будут минусы - баланс может закончится с помощью дополнительных сервисов и тогда у абонента возникнут вопросы, если его отключат по недостатку баланса. Лучше конечно, списать всю сумму сразу, за весь период.

Неужели никто длинные тарифы не делает?

Автор:  skn [ 15 сен 2011, 15:05 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

модуль АП не расчитан на такой режим, это не периодическое списание.

Автор:  mikos [ 15 сен 2011, 15:08 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

skn писал(а):
модуль АП не расчитан на такой режим, это не периодическое списание.

А какие есть варианты?

Автор:  skn [ 15 сен 2011, 15:10 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

скрипты, хотя я не строник подобных тарифов, много потенциальных проблем.

Автор:  mikos [ 21 сен 2011, 19:37 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

skn писал(а):
скрипты, хотя я не строник подобных тарифов, много потенциальных проблем.

Понятно. Спасибо.

Вопрос тогда по годовому списанию АП.
В документации написано "Погодовой режим снятия - начисление только в месяц добавление абонплаты догвору (раз в год)".
Отлично, но абонплата добавляется у нас один раз при подключении абонента и она находится там все время жизни договора. А вот тарифы меняются по запросу абонента, в том числе и из web интерфейса. Если абонплата у абонента стоит с числом древним, а тариф годовой повесить этого месяца, то в этом месяце ничего списано не будет - проверено.
Зачем эта баго-фича? Как теперь годовые тарифы народу давать? Абонплату скриптом пересоздавать чтоли?

Автор:  skn [ 21 сен 2011, 23:17 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

mikos писал(а):
Зачем эта баго-фича? Как теперь годовые тарифы народу давать? Абонплату скриптом пересоздавать чтоли?


разовыми списаниями... + скрипты

Автор:  mikos [ 22 сен 2011, 00:24 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

skn писал(а):
mikos писал(а):
Зачем эта баго-фича? Как теперь годовые тарифы народу давать? Абонплату скриптом пересоздавать чтоли?


разовыми списаниями... + скрипты

К сожалению не уловил мысль. У нас есть тариф, в котором у модуля "Абонплата" есть ветка с годовым списанием и соответствующей стоимостью. Теперь если абоненту, с уже имеющейся записью абонплаты, выдать этот тариф, то никакого списания, ни в этом, ни в следующем, ни в какие последющие по всей видимости тоже, списаний не будет.

Подскажите пожалуйста, как использовать тариф, с годовым списанием АП?

Автор:  skn [ 22 сен 2011, 22:02 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

mikos писал(а):
Подскажите пожалуйста, как использовать тариф, с годовым списанием АП?


судя по всему этот режим не работает и я даже не знаю как его реализовать...

биллинг расчитан на работу с месячными периодами, т.е. расчет ведеться с начала текущего месяца и по текущую дату
в случае годовых абонплат это не прокатывает, обсчет ведется по наработке текущего месяца, а проверять наработку надо за весь год, а там может быть закрытый период и т.д.
при начисление абонплат при каждом запуске они удаляются за текущий месяц и начисляются заново, в случае годовой абонплаты надо ее удалять за весь год, перерасчитывать баланс за весь год, затем делать начисления и заново перерасчитывать баланс за год.

Автор:  mikos [ 22 сен 2011, 22:44 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

Понял, спасибо

Автор:  maxst-net [ 09 янв 2020, 17:40 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

Столкнулись с похожей проблемой. "Годовой тарифный план" списывает абон. плату первого числа, хотя тариф в договоре был установлен двадцать восьмого числа. Судя по всему стандартной логики обработки данной ситуации не предусмотрено? Объясните, пожалуйста, "на пальцах", что нужно сделать, что бы абон. плата списывалась ровно через год от момента установки ТП.

Код:
  Сервер: вер. 6.2.1149 / 22.12.2016 16:33:23
    os: Linux; java: Java HotSpot(TM) 64-Bit Server VM, v.1.8.0_77


Вложения:
narabotka.png
narabotka.png [ 56.34 КБ | Просмотров: 5377 ]
tp.png
tp.png [ 66.09 КБ | Просмотров: 5377 ]

Автор:  Phricker [ 09 янв 2020, 17:50 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

https://docs.bitel.ru/pages/viewpage.ac ... d=43385552

Автор:  zavndw [ 09 янв 2020, 17:50 ]
Заголовок сообщения:  Re: Списание АП раз в N-месяцев

Меняйте абонентскую плату в тот же и все. Будет списывать как надо, если не ошибаюсь. Это используя стандартную логику

Страница 1 из 1 Часовой пояс: UTC + 5 часов [ Летнее время ]
Powered by phpBB® Forum Software © phpBB Group
http://www.phpbb.com/